Colts sign Matt Jones after cutting him three days ago
Matt Jones is once again a member of the Colts after being released by the team less than a week ago.
After being released by the Redskins earlier this month, Jones was claimed off of Waivers by the Colts on September 3. Last Saturday, Indianapolis announced they had waived the 24-year-old running back. On Tuesday, Jones was once a Colt once more.

The move caps a whirlwind couple of week for Jones, who is in his third season after being selected in the third round of the 2015 NFL Draft. Jones spent last season with the Redskins and started all seven games he appeared in. Jones rushed for 460 yards and three touchdowns.
